命じる (めいじる): meaning and examples

Key takeaways

命じる (めいじる) means to order / to command / to appoint.

Basic example sentences

Example 1

先生は学生に宿題を命じた。

Translation

The teacher ordered the students to do homework.

Example 2

会社は彼を新しい部長に命じた。

Translation

The company appointed him as the new manager.
